Florida Man Faces Murder Charges in 2024 Cold Case: Shocking Details Emerge

A Florida man has been taken into custody and charged with the murder of a 24-year-old woman who vanished in 2024.

Ronald Chester Racki, a 75-year-old used car salesman, was arrested by Venice Police on Friday. He faces charges of second-degree murder in connection with the death of Laikyn Marie West, who was last seen on September 13, 2024. The announcement was made in a recent Facebook post by the Venice Police.

West’s disappearance was reported by her roommate three days after she went missing, according to a report by the Herald-Tribune.

“After months of dedicated and coordinated investigative efforts, the evidence gathered has led to this arrest and charge,” stated Venice Police Chief Andy Leisenring. “We are steadfast in our commitment to securing justice for Laikyn West and providing her family with the answers they deserve.”

Investigators have disclosed that cell phone records indicate communication between Racki and West on the day she disappeared. The records reveal that Racki arranged to meet West to pay for sex. He reportedly picked her up at her residence in Bradenton and drove her to Venice for lunch.

Then, he said, West asked him to stop and buy drugs, but he refused, saying he dropped her off in Bradenton.

But no witnesses corroborated that statement, and license plate readers didn’t pick up any vehicle registered to Racki in the area.

Racki met with detectives on December 14, 2024, after they had found an entry in West’s journal saying that a man had paied her $950 to allow him to chloroform her during sex. He told the detectives that he had fantasized about it but “never really chloroformed her,” although he said he had chloroform that he used to clean car seats. He also denied paying West $950.

He suggested that West may have overdosed or perhaps had a medical condition.

On December 20, investigators executed a search warrant on Racki’s phone and found photographs of west lying naked and bound with zip ties and handcuffs. One of the photos was taken on September 13, 2024, the day she was last seen.

Racki’s phone also contained searches for violent pornography and “snuff” content. On the same day, the Sarasota Sheriff’s Office responded to a an attempted suicide by Racki. He was taken to Sarasota Memorial Hospital, where he stayed until January 1.

While he was in the hospital, he reportedly told a nurse he’d killed four weomen, but investigators say they found no evidence that any victims other than West exist.

In April last year, a car detailer told investigators that he had deep cleaned  a pickup truck for Racki around September 2024 and saw a stain on the rear floor but he had no paper records of the cleaning.

West’s body has not been found.

Racki is being held in the Sarasota County Jail without bond.
